Beverly Moore Weakley Obituary

Beverly Moore Weakley
December 16, 1929 ~ March 14, 2008
 
SALINAS – Beverly, 78, passed away after a five-year illness, which ended in pneumonia. Her passing was peaceful. She is survived by her sister, Barbara Brookman of Laguna Niguel, CA; her son, Craig Weakley of Anacortes, WA; her daughter, Carrie Gummer of Indio, CA; four grandchildren: Jason Fernandez, Zaundra Fernandez, Melissa Romano-Harris, and Brittany Gummer; one great-grandson, Logan Fernandez; and two nephews, Kevin and Brad Brookman.
   Born in Salinas and a lifelong resident, she was known and loved by many. She graduated from Salinas High School and Pomona College. She was a first class kindergarten teacher in the Salinas Elementary School District for over 30 years. She participated in Junior League, Camp Fire Girls and Boy Scouts. She was a member of the First Presbyterian Church and also attended Sacred Heart Catholic Church. She loved music and playing the piano. Upon retiring, she enjoyed bridge parties, entertaining in her home, volunteering and traveling. She volunteered for The Rodeo, The Friends of Monterey Symphony and the Steinbeck House. She loved to take cruises and to visit New York and Washington, D.C. She loved "Gone with the Wind", Nelson Eddy and Jeanette MacDonald movies, Frank Sinatra, Petula Clark and Burt Bacharach. She was a devoted daughter, a loving mother and a friend to all. She will be dearly missed.
   A Celebration of Beverly's life will be held April 12, 2008 from 1:00 to 4:00 p.m. at 239 Pine Street in Salinas.  In lieu of flowers, please donate to First Presbyterian Church in Salinas, The Monterey Symphony, or The Monterey Bay Aquarium.
